oat in Dutch

oat in Dutch is haver — oat means a cereal grass grown for its edible grain.

oat in Dutch

haver
noun
(uncountable) Widely cultivated cereal grass, typically Avena sativa.

What does "oat" mean?

  1. noun A cereal grass grown for its edible grain.
    "Farmers planted oat in the north field this year."
  2. noun The grain of this plant, used as food or animal feed (usually plural: oats).
    "She sprinkled oat flakes over her yoghurt."
